This outlet provides content through email to functional-level titles within all sizes of MSP organizations and serves content to executive titles within smaller growth-oriented MSPs. The fundamentals of working with writers at internet magazines are the same as with traditional journalists at traditional media outlets: respect their schedules; take time to read their material to learn their interests; and only contact them if/when they want to be contacted.     Chinese Management Studies

    Background and Format: Chinese Management Studies documents research into Chinese processes of managing enterprises, firms and corporations. It includes In-depth analysis of Chinese managerial thinking, philosophy and processes, empirical pieces on Chinese management. The journal fosters research by Chinese scholars across China, as well as the work of international researchers. Audience and Readership: Aimed at scholars in universities worldwide and managers who wish to understand, or communicate, Chinese thinking and managerial practices. Circulation: The Publisher does not disclose the figure.  Ad Rates: This journal does not carry advertising. Other information: Submission guidelines can be found here.

    CIO

    Established in 1987 and edited for information executives, their partners and their companies. Addresses the issues affecting IT executives by providing readers with in-depth coverage. Focuses on IT issues and trends from a management perspective, targeting senior level IT and other top executives who control the purchase and strategic application of technology products and services. Articles focus on how information executives help create solutions that address competitive business challenges. Sections include: features; interviews; columns; case studies; survey and report results; Trendlines, a section focusing on the new, the hot and the unexpected; and Emerging Technology, a section focusing on innovation and products. Research areas include: Budgeting (keeping spending on track and in line), Customer Relationship Management (understanding your customers), Data Storage/Mining, E-business (resources for doing business online),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P), Future CIO (helping you make smart career decisions), Globalization (IT and the global economy), Government and IT Policy (insight into politics and policies shaping the 21st century government), Infrastructure, Intranet/Extranet, IT Professional (how to effectively develop your IT career), IT Value (connect the dots between IT expenditures and financial benefits), Knowledge Management, Leadership and Management, Learning (educational tools for the IT organization), Outsourcing, Security and Privacy, Staffing and Retention, Supply Chain Management and Wireless Communications.     Computerworld

    Established in 1967 and serves as a vital and respected source of news, business and technology information for IT executives and professionals at medium to large corporations who are on the forefront of the move to e-business and adoption of new technologies. Editorial coverage emphasizes and advocates for the user perspective, providing balanced, objective reporting on a wide range of technologies, business trends, career topics and management issues. Connects the IT community as a daily resource for leaders to interact with their peers and to keep abreast of the issues, trends and specific technologies that affect their jobs every day. The site complements the print edition of Computerworld with a continuous feed of technology news and analysis, as well as research and others services only available online. Computerworld DOES NOT accept bylined articles, contributions or submissions. The outlet offers RSS (Really Simple Syndication).

    TechRepublic

    Founded in 1997, TechRepublic serves as the ultimate professional resource and community for members of the IT sector, including CEOs, CIOs, CFOs, CMOs, IT directors, IT managers, IT professionals, and everyone whose job requires making decisions about technology. Includes a family of virtual communities called republics, which organize editorial by job function, providing expert niche content, as well as peer-to-peer advice. Features blogs, videos, vendor white papers, software downloads, Webcasts and research. Topics covered include: IT Management Compliance IT Consultant Business Intelligence Project Management Web Development Software Development Web Development IT Support Microsoft Windows Apple OSX Linux Mobile Computing Desktop Applications Data Center Cloud Computing Database Administration Servers Storage Virtualization Networks LAN/WAN Wireless Unified Communications VoIP Security Anti-Malware IT Risk Management Additionally offers international editions in the United Kingdom, Australia and Japan.
